The journey from Assolna to Satara covers 350 km, taking you through the scenic Chorla Ghat and onto the NH 48 highway. This route connects Goa to the heart of Maharashtra. The drive takes about 7 to 9 hours. Satara is famous for its forts and the nearby Kaas Plateau. This route is popular with tourists heading to the Sahyadri mountains.

Total Distance: Driving distance is 350 km; straight-line air distance is 280 km.

Best Time to Travel

September to February, when the weather is cool and the plateau is in bloom.

Things to Do in Satara
1
Ajinkyatara Fort
Trek to this historic fort for a panoramic view of the city. It is a significant Maratha landmark.
2
Kaas Plateau
Visit the 'Valley of Flowers' of Maharashtra. It is a UNESCO World Heritage site.
3
Thoseghar Waterfalls
See the stunning series of waterfalls. It is a great spot for nature lovers.
4
Sajjangad Fort
Visit the final resting place of Saint Ramdas. It is a place of great spiritual importance.
